在医疗行业,创新和效率一直是推动进步的关键因素。随着技术的不断发展,低代码开发作为一种新兴的软件开发方法,正逐渐改变着医疗行业的面貌。本文将探讨低代码开发如何重塑医疗行业的创新与效率。
引言
低代码开发是一种允许用户通过图形界面而非传统编程语言来创建应用程序的方法。这种方法简化了软件开发过程,降低了技术门槛,使得非技术背景的用户也能参与到应用开发中来。在医疗行业,低代码开发的应用前景广阔,以下将从几个方面详细阐述其影响。
低代码开发在医疗行业的应用
1. 临床决策支持系统
低代码平台可以快速构建临床决策支持系统(CDSS),帮助医生在诊断和治疗过程中做出更准确的决策。通过整合患者数据、医学知识库和临床指南,CDSS能够提供个性化的治疗建议。
// 示例:使用低代码平台构建的CDSS代码片段
function diagnosePatient(patientData) {
// 分析患者数据
// 引用医学知识库和临床指南
// 返回诊断结果和治疗建议
}
2. 电子健康记录(EHR)系统
低代码开发可以简化EHR系统的构建和维护,提高数据录入和查询的效率。通过可视化界面,医护人员可以轻松地添加、编辑和查询患者信息。
# 示例:使用低代码平台构建的EHR系统代码片段
class ElectronicHealthRecord:
def __init__(self):
self.patient_data = []
def add_patient(self, patient_info):
# 添加患者信息到数据库
pass
def get_patient_info(self, patient_id):
# 根据患者ID查询信息
pass
3. 医疗物联网(IoT)
低代码开发可以快速搭建医疗物联网应用,实现设备数据的实时监控和分析。例如,通过低代码平台可以轻松构建一个用于监测患者生命体征的物联网系统。
// 示例:使用低代码平台构建的IoT系统代码片段
public class PatientMonitor {
// 连接传感器,获取数据
// 分析数据,触发警报
// 将数据存储到数据库
}
低代码开发的优势
1. 提高开发效率
低代码开发平台提供了丰富的组件和模板,大大缩短了开发周期。这对于快速响应医疗行业的需求具有重要意义。
2. 降低技术门槛
非技术背景的用户可以通过低代码平台进行应用开发,降低了医疗行业对专业开发人员的依赖。
3. 促进创新
低代码开发平台为医护人员提供了更多的时间和精力去关注创新,从而推动医疗行业的发展。
挑战与展望
尽管低代码开发在医疗行业具有广阔的应用前景,但仍面临一些挑战,如数据安全、隐私保护等。未来,随着技术的不断进步,低代码开发平台将更加成熟,为医疗行业带来更多可能性。
总之,低代码开发正在重塑医疗行业的创新与效率。通过简化开发流程、降低技术门槛,低代码开发为医疗行业带来了新的发展机遇。随着技术的不断进步,我们有理由相信,低代码开发将在医疗领域发挥越来越重要的作用。
